Stay in Barcelona (Part 5) Sagrada Familia Church by Antoni Gaudi

This is the final works of Antoni Gaudi and from the photos you will see that this church is still under construction. There are 2 sides to this church and will notice that the ending few photos, the style is very different from all the other part of the church. It is because the back of this church is done by another designer who is more of abstract artist, therefore the style differs a lot from Gaudi's work.

I took many close-up photos of the details. So take time to enjoy every little detail that are put into this building. It is art, it is a masterpiece. There is so much going on that but taking a glance, you would have missed out on so much more.

You can see that the lay out of the church is like the tabernacle of the old testament. Where there is a outer court, Holy place and Holy of Holies (where the sculpture of Jesus is hanging over) as shown in the photos above.

Stay in Barcelona (Part 4) Park Güell by Antoni Gaudi

This whole park is designed by the same designer, Antoni Gaudi.
Where he devoted around 45 years of his life, staying in this park to build and design this park

If you noticed, there are some elements in Gaudi's design that is like his trademark.
The CROSS... His religion as a Catholic.
The outer pillars are always leaning inwards to increase stability of the structure, just like how we are in a standing position with our feet apart.
